Sugar Skull Mug

These colourful sugar skull mugs are a fun Day of the Dead craft activity that children of all ages can enjoy.

Sugar Skull Mug

Skill Level

Beginner

Time to Make

45 minutes

Adult Supervision Needed

Yes

How to Make

  1. Use the thin black outline pen to draw a skull face onto the front of the mug. Fill in the eyes and nose and draw the outline of the skull either side.
  2. Using a range of different coloured porcelain pens, draw a mixture of flowers, heart and circles onto the skull and leave to dry.
  3. Use the black outline pen to create a thin outline around each colourful shape that you drew. This will make them really stand out.
  4. Decorate the rest of the mug with multicoloured hearts, flowers and circles and leave to dry.
  5. Bake in the oven if you wish to set the pattern, follow the instructions on the side of the porcelain pens to do this.

Top Tip

Wait until the ink has completely dried after each step to prevent the colours running.
